**TopMat** is a specialized high-throughput coding framework designed for the search and classification of **Magnetic Topological Materials**. Based on the theory of **Magnetic Topological Quantum Chemistry (MTQC)**, it extends topological indicators to all 1651 Magnetic Space Groups (MSGs). It was the engine behind the construction of the Magnetic Topological Materials Database, enabling the identification of hundreds of new magnetic topological insulators and semimetals.
